How the 1km priority works
  1. 1 Within 1km wins. MOE ranks P1 applicants by straight-line distance from the school — within 1km, then 1–2km, then beyond. Singapore Citizens rank above PRs in each band.
  2. 2 It only bites if the school ballots. At 2025 Phase 2C, Singapore Chinese Girls' Primary School drew about 1.4 applicants per place, so distance decided the ballot.
  3. 3 You must stay 30 months. To use Home-School Distance priority, the family must live at the registered address for at least 30 months from the start of P1 registration.

Distances are straight-line estimates from each block to the school's postal point — indicative only. Confirm the exact figure with MOE's official distance guide.

Why does living within 1km of Singapore Chinese Girls' Primary School matter for P1 registration?

If a school is oversubscribed and goes to ballot, MOE gives priority by home-school distance: Singapore Citizens within 1km first, then 1–2km, then beyond 2km. A home within 1km gives your child the best chance in a ballot.

How competitive is Singapore Chinese Girls' Primary School at P1 registration?

At Phase 2C of the 2025 P1 exercise (Singapore Citizens within 1km), Singapore Chinese Girls' Primary School drew about 1.41 applicants for every place (58 applicants for 41 vacancies), so it went to ballot. Distance priority decides who gets in. Figures via p1registration.sg.
